NEW YORK— A JetBlue Airways (B6) flight arriving from Kingston, Jamaica (KIN), experienced a tense few moments in the skies over New York (JFK) on April 12, 2025 as it was forced into multiple go-arounds due to air traffic spacing, ultimately prompting the crew to declare minimum fuel.
The incident highlights a delicate balance between air traffic control efficiency and airline fuel management, especially during busy arrival periods.
